Recruitment | Executive Search

Danish speaking Content Moderator job – Competitive salary + benefits – Cape Town, South AfricaPortuguese speaking Marketing Customer Support Representative job – Competitive salary + benefits – Cape Town, South AfricaSpanish speaking Marketing Customer Care Associate job – Competitive salary + benefits – Cape Town, South AfricaGreek speaking Junior Marketing Assistant job – Market related salary – Cape Town, South AfricaGerman speaking Media Analyst job – Market related salary – Cape Town, South AfricaPortuguese speaking Copywriter job – Market related salary – Cape Town, South AfricaItalian speaking Social Media Assistant job – Market Related Salary – Cape Town, South AfricaSwedish speaking Social Media Manager job – Market Related Salary – Cape Town, South AfricaEuro-French speaking Marketing Manager job – Market Related Salary – Johannesburg, South AfricaFrench speaking Marketing and Promotions Manager job – Market Related Salary – Cape Town, South Africa